Tancredi


This “Sedimentation” came about while relating to the Tancredi painting, “Composizione astratta. Soggiorno a Venezia”, oil on faesite, 93.3 x 127.8cm, housed at the Ca’ Pesaro Museum in Venice.
To define the project of the work I created for the “Casa Scatturin” where the painter Tancredi had lived at various times, it was necessary to go and see this painting in the art gallery on more than one occasion in order to relate to his painting, his palette and his mood.
I sat in front of this painting for months, taking a colour and stratifying it on my canvas. My “Sedimentation” is the result of these visits and of my encounter with this painting.

(Written in 2019)
